The Paris 2024 Olympic and Paralympic Games are set to be a global spectacle, showcasing the world’s finest athletes as they compete for glory. For viewers in the U.S., NBCUniversal’s coverage will not only bring the excitement of Team USA athletes like Dani Aravich, Jagger Eaton, Ilona Maher, Victor Montalvo, Kelsey Plum, and Fred Richard to life but will also integrate cutting-edge Google technologies to enhance the viewing experience. Through a groundbreaking partnership with Team USA and NBCUniversal, Google will showcase its latest innovations in Search, Google Maps Platform, and Gemini, making it easier than ever to explore, learn, and engage with the Games.
Here’s a closer look at how Google’s products will feature in NBCUniversal’s Paris 2024 coverage:
1. Explain the Games with Google Search
During NBCU’s daytime and primetime broadcasts, announcers will demonstrate how Google Search’s AI Overviews can provide quick, digestible insights into sports, athletes, and events. Whether you’re curious about the significance of swim lanes, the rules of Olympic basketball, or the role of guide runners in Paralympic Track and Field, Google Search will deliver instant answers and links for deeper exploration.
2. Dig Deeper with Gemini
Leslie Jones, NBC’s “chief superfan commentator,” will use Gemini to dive into the Games. Through segments on NBC and Peacock, Leslie will leverage Gemini’s capabilities to learn about new sports, explore Team USA’s journey, and engage with the action in innovative ways.
3. Explore Paris with Search, Maps, and Gemini
NBCUniversal’s social media channels will feature U.S. Olympians and Paralympians exploring Paris using Google Lens, Circle to Search, Immersive View in Google Maps, and Gemini. These tools will allow athletes to share their unique experiences of the city, from iconic landmarks to hidden gems, based on their personal interests.
4. See Google Maps Platform Bring Paris Landmarks to Life
Google Maps Platform’s Photorealistic 3D Tiles will take center stage during NBCU’s broadcasts, offering breathtaking 3D views of Paris’s Olympic venues, including Versailles, Roland Garros, and the Aquatics Centre. This immersive technology will transport viewers to the heart of the action, making them feel like they’re right there in Paris.
The integration of Google’s technologies into NBCUniversal’s coverage will begin with the Opening Ceremony on July 26, promising a viewing experience that’s as informative as it is thrilling.
